// MAX_BACKTRACK_DEPTH bounds the Wrenfield timetable solver's
// constraint-propagation retries per slot. Raising it past 40
// blew heap on the Year 9 fixture set; lowering below 12 leaves
// double-booked labs unresolved. Tuned against the autumn term
// benchmark; do not change without rerunning it. Solver build
// verified under the token noted below.

session token of fahap-hawip = htk31_7852f2b3276dba2738f98fa97f92237

Facilities Ticket — Cleaning Crew Access, Brindle Annex

For new starters handling evening lock-up: the Sorano Cleaning crew arrives nightly at 21:30 via the annex side door. Check their rota sheet, note arrival in the log, and ensure the storeroom is relocked afterward. To let them through the side door, enter the access code below.

badge for yaweg-hafog: bdg-GX-6

### Runbook: Report export timezone mismatches (Glimmerfield)

If a customer reports that exported totals differ from the dashboard, check whether their report schedule predates the March cutover — older schedules still render in server-local time rather than the account timezone. Re-saving the schedule fixes it. Before escalating, confirm the export worker is running with the expected timezone settings shown below.

config for kadup-kajog:
[raldor]
host = raldor.tolvaqworks.internal
user = raldor_svc
database = raldor_prod

FAQ — Thumbstack Queue Recovery

Q: The Thumbstack thumbnail queue is stuck mid-release. How do I drain and restart it?

A: Pause the producers, flush the pending batch, and restart the workers from the release console. The flush command requires elevated confirmation. When prompted, supply the recovery passphrase given below.

unlock words, hahip-yagef: zorok-novmir-zorix-silax

Proposed training budget for next year: flat overall, reallocated toward technical certification for the Nordquist platform rollout. Cuts: external conferences down 30%; leadership offsites consolidated to one. Additions: internal academy pilot at the Ravensmoor site, mentorship stipends for senior engineers. Heads of department should submit headcount-based estimates using the standard template. No exceptions processed after the deadline. Rationale tied to strategic direction is covered in the confidential note below.

internal memo for hahaf-kahof: Only 39 of the 428 pilot accounts renewed Sorion, so a churn review is set for April 12. Praokix Freight is in early talks to buy Queniusox Group for about $145.8 million.